Our story
Ode Ritual was founded in Kyoto by Min and friends. Here is Min’s story, in her own words.
For much of my life, I lived in constant motion—building a successful career in top global companies, traveling the world, always chasing the next milestone. From the outside, it was a life many might aspire to. But inside, I often felt disconnected—from myself, and from the small things that once brought me joy.
One autumn while in between jobs, I spent a few quiet months in Kyoto. Away from the rush, I settled into a slower rhythm. I jogged along the Kamogawa River each morning, and on weekends, I sat at a local teahouse, enjoying warm matcha with a book. They were simple routines, yet over time, I came to see that they were in fact, rituals—intentional, grounding acts that gave stillness and presence.
Several years later, I left my corporate path and moved to Kyoto, immersing myself in Chadō and ceramics. These practices, and the quiet beauty of the city, became the inspiration for Ode Ritual. Starting Ode Ritual has been a leap of faith, but it’s brought me back to what truly matters.
